This book appears to be a less colorful reprint of the original that was published by Real People Press of Moab, Utah in 1969-70 and in subsequent North American and international reprinted editions.
The black and white art on the cover looks to be altered reprints taken from interior illustrations present in the original RPP editions.
It should be noted that Fritz personally requested the artist, Gustav Russ Youngreen - Dr. Gry, illustrate his autobiography. Fritz approved each of Gry's drawings for the book.
Is the Gestalt Journal edition illustrated? Perhaps not. The original illustrations lent something to Perls' book and were noteworthy in that in terms of current psychotherapist's autobiographies, it offered a welcome departure.
Perls autobiography reflects the many facets of the man and is a more than entertaining read. Not being the usual pedantic, piled higher and deeper defense or intellectual criticism of a concept or phenomenon, In and Out of The Garbage Pail playfully reminds us of our 'garbage' ridden lives.
